The Odessa,Welcome to HealingWell. I can not confirm or deny what you think may be causing your problems but would strongly suggest you make an appointment at the clinic or visit and urgent care for a medical screening exam.
I suspect you may have a bit of anxiety going on too. Feel comfortable posting in the anxiety re your sx as anxiety can cause many of these symptoms also.